Life & Work with Anne Gish

Today we’d like to introduce you to Anne Gish.

Thank you so much for sharing your story and insight with our readers. To kick things off, can you tell us a bit about how you got started?
This business has been an exciting result of high interest in fashion, design, and circumstance.

Initially, I wanted to be a part of an interior design program at the school I wanted to attend, but they eliminated it before I had a chance to start.

After years of being a stay-at-home mom and supporting my husband’s firefighter/paramedic career, he had to retire early, and we needed a new beginning! My husband and I decided to look into real estate. We found investors and studied how to flip houses and earn a living with the housing market. During our time of flipping homes, I made all of the design decisions, including walls that needed to come down, paint colors, tile, and finishes. I soaked all of it in. It felt so good to be doing something so helpful but ultimately so satisfying and fun! As the flips were winding down, I took on the staging piece of the project, and it was like Christmas for me. After 3 years of our flips, I got up the courage to offer my services publicly. I’m new to owning my own business and some particulars, but my intuition and experience are solid. I’m so excited to serve our community in this way!

Thanks for sharing that. So, maybe next you can tell us more about your work?
I offer home staging for homes ready for sale: vacant homes and investment properties.

I love making a home look comfortable but high quality.

I’m a mother who has prioritized my family’s comfort in our home. I’m personable, relatable, and professional. I LOVE what I do, and I’m so excited to be able to help others in the process.
